What happens when we do something wrong and the guilt just won’t go away?
Join Tom and Sara as an ordinary school day turns into an important lesson about guilt, confession, and mercy.
After Tom cheats on a test at school, he spends the entire weekend feeling the heavy weight of guilt. He knows what he did was wrong, but he is afraid to admit the truth. When he finally confesses what he has done, Tom expects the worst.
But something surprising happens.
Instead of receiving the punishment he fears, Tom is given another chance. Through this experience, he begins to understand what mercy really means.
This meaningful Christian children’s story helps young readers begin to understand:
• Why guilt reminds us when we do wrong
• Why confessing our sin is important
• What mercy really means
• How God shows mercy to us even when we don’t deserve it
